The city of Tulum was previously known as Zama, meaning City of Dawn. Being both on a sea and land route, it had major historical importance as a centre of trading. The city flourished between the 13th and the 15th centuries, fading only 70 years after the Spanish army started conquering today’s Mexico. Tulum ruins are perched on 12 metre high cliffs facing the Caribbean Sea.
